What is the difference between dna and rna
horrorfan [7]
DNA<span> is a long polymer with deoxyribose and phosphate backbone. Having four different nitrogenous bases: adenine, guanine, cytosine and thymine. </span>RNA<span> is a polymer with a ribose and phosphate backbone. Four different nitrogenous bases: adenine, guanine, cytosine, and uracil.</span><span />

Which of the following is a modification of the simple columnar epithelium that allows for efficient absorption along portions o
Elena-2011 [213]

Answer:

C) dense microvilli

Explanation:

The modification of simple columnar epithelium that allows for efficient absorption along the digestive tract is Dense microvilli.

microvilli increase the surface area of the simple columnar cells allowing more space and opportunities for nutrients to be absorbed from the lumen of the intestine into the bloodstream.

Microvilli are microscopic cellular membrane protrusions that increase the surface area for diffusion and minimize any increase in volume. They are involved in a wide variety of functions, which include absorption, secretion, cellular adhesion, and mechanotransduction.
